How foreclosure works in Texas
- ✓Texas residential foreclosures are typically non-judicial (handled through a trustee under a deed of trust's power of sale, not a court).
- ✓The process usually starts with a notice of default and then a notice of sale before the sale date.
- ✓You can generally sell the home any time before the trustee's sale is completed.
This reflects the general Texas process as of 2026-07 and is not legal advice — confirm the specifics of your situation with a qualified attorney.

Can I sell my house after a Notice of Default?⌄
Yes. In Texas, you can generally sell your home any time before the trustee's sale is completed. A cash sale can happen quickly enough to stop the foreclosure.
How long do I have before the foreclosure auction in Texas?⌄
The timeline can vary. The process typically starts with a notice of default, followed by a notice of sale before the auction date. For your specific timeline, consult a qualified professional.
Will selling stop the foreclosure and protect my credit?⌄
Yes, selling your home before the trustee's sale stops the foreclosure process and can help you avoid the severe credit consequences of a foreclosure. For personalized credit advice, speak with a financial professional.
Do I owe anything if the sale doesn't cover my mortgage?⌄
This depends on your mortgage terms and Texas law. We recommend talking with a real estate attorney or financial advisor to understand any potential deficiency.
